Описание: The proposed Division 296 tax is one of the most significant superannuation changes in recent years—and it could have broader implications than many investors realise.

In this video, we break down how the new tax applies to super balances above $3 million, and what it means for high-net-worth individuals, property investors, and SMSF trustees in Australia.

While the policy is framed as a superannuation reform, its impact may extend into how investors structure, hold, and plan their property and long-term wealth strategies.

For investors holding property inside SMSFs, or those approaching higher super balances, the introduction of Division 296 may require a reassessment of long-term strategy.

Key considerations include:

✔ Reviewing how and when capital gains are realised
✔ Ensuring sufficient liquidity to meet potential tax obligations
✔ Evaluating whether current structures align with future goals
✔ Understanding how policy changes may influence investment decisions
✔ Seeking advice early to avoid rushed or reactive decisions
